Walks in Ribble Country (Cicerone)
Ref: CIC095
The River Ribble rises in the wild heights of the Yorkshire Dales and flows for 75 miles through some of the loveliest and most varied scenery that Yorkshire and Lancashire have to offer. This idyllic countryside provides the setting for these 30 delightful circular walks. They have been selected to appeal to all tastes, and range from simple valley strolls to strenuous fell expeditions. Hand-written and illustrated in Jack Keighley's highly distinctive style, each chapter contains: oParking information oA meticulously detailed map oConcise route descriptions oA general description of the terrain oNotes on features of interest.
The walks are fairly uniform in length, an average of 6 1/2 miles, making them half-day rather than full-day excursions.
